Job Description:
Description:The TSUBAKI name is synonymous with excellence in
quality, dependability and customer service. U.S. Tsubaki
Automotive, LLC is an international tier-one supplier of high-speed
chain drive systems to the automotive industry. The Product
Development Engineer will be responsible for accelerating the
development and time-to-market of Tsubaki mobility products.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ities: The essential duties and
responsibilities of this job are included but not limited to this
job description - other tasks may be assigned and expected to be
performed.Research, design, and develop products for Tsubaki's
family of automotive and mobility products. This includes
selectable clutches, driveline disconnects, park lock devices,
chain actuators, and other chain drive solutions. Design for
Manufacturing: Optimize component designs, identify manufacturing
methods, material specifications, and manufacturing
tolerances.Create Design Validation Plans, Gantt Charts, DFMEAs,
and lead Design Reviews (internal and supply chain). Coordinate
engineering drawing approvals and releases, update and release Bill
of Materials, and support drawing implementation with
cross-functional team. Communicate applicable engineering
specifications to team. Support product and documentation
refinement from the concept stage to mass production.Coordinate
with cross-functional APQP team on product/project launches.
Support APQP objectives with cross-functional team activities such
as: Process Flow Diagrams, Control Plans, and PFMEAs.Continue
application of Tsubaki Chain technologies to of the Automotive and
Mobility industries. Support Sales and New Product Groups on new
business opportunities and VA/VE ideas.Provide technical support to
other departments.Requirements:Bachelor's degree in Mechanical
Engineering required.Familiarity with automotive
engines/transmissions, knowledge of AIAG standards and practices,
and enthusiasm for the automotive industry preferred.CAD skills
required. NX, CATIA, Solidworks preferred.Familiarity with analysis
and simulation software preferred.Ability to learn complex testing
and instrumentation required.Ability to multi-task and prioritize
work required. Excellent time management skills required.Broadband
knowledge of manufacturing processes preferred (stamping, forging,
sintering, injection molding, machining, heat treatment, etc.)
Ability to think critically and creatively in high stress
situations.Willingness & ability to travel as necessary.U.S.
